Output 8c982654abc6680087206657c939828ea990b793e65e24e0150334ec37c8bdb3:0

value
2960809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 033cf67d15289619d59f5951a04771a62ffba80c OP_EQUAL
address
31z8yth7V6ci7WQMHrDGpjxmqeTqMmTTGc
transaction
8c982654abc6680087206657c939828ea990b793e65e24e0150334ec37c8bdb3
spent
true